THE value 'oi this well-known Family Medicine has been largely tested m all parts of the world, and by all grades of society, for upwards of FIFTY YEARS. Its well-earned, extensive sale has induced SPURIOUS IMITATIONS, come of which m OUTWARD APPEARANCE so closely resemble the original as to have deceived many purchasers. The proprietor, therefore, feels it due to the public to give a special caution against the use of SUCH IMITATIONS. Purchasers are therefore requested to carefully observe the four following im« portant characteristics, without which none is genuine :— lat— ln avery case the words JOHN STEEDMAN, CHEMIST, WALWOfiTH, SURREY, are engraved on the Government Stamp affixed to eaoh packet -„ 2nd.— Each Single Powder has directions for the dose, and the wordjj, Jofev Stbkdkah, Chemist, Walworth, Surrey, printed thereon. Brd.— The name, Steedman, is always spelt with two EE's. 4th,— The manufacture is carried on solely at Walworth, Surrey.
